3. The Budget Blind Spot: Forgetting the "What Ifs"
We all start with a number in mind, but many homeowners forget that a remodel is an evolving process. In Central Florida’s older homes, opening a wall can sometimes reveal "surprises": outdated wiring, plumbing quirks, or structural shifts that weren't visible on the surface. If your budget is stretched to the absolute limit from day one, these surprises can turn into a nightmare.
How to Fix It: When planning your modern kitchen remodeling Orlando, always include a 10% to 20% contingency fund. This isn't "extra" money to spend on fancy gadgets; it’s your peace of mind. By having a buffer, you can navigate the unexpected without compromising on the quality of your finished home. 4. Disregarding the Flow: Form Without Function
A kitchen can be "exquisite" to look at, but if it’s a struggle to move from the sink to the stove, it fails its primary purpose. The "work triangle": the relationship between your refrigerator, sink, and cooking surface: is a classic design principle for a reason. Ignoring this flow results in a kitchen that feels cramped and frustrating to use.

How to Fix It: Focus on the "dance" of your daily routine. Where do you prep? Where do you clean? If you are planning a large island, ensure there is enough clearance for people to pass through while the dishwasher is open. 5. Overcomplicating the Infrastructure: The Layout Shift
Moving your sink or your gas range to the other side of the room sounds like a great way to "open things up," but it is one of the most significant cost-drivers in any remodel. Relocating plumbing stacks, gas lines, and electrical panels requires extensive labor and permitting that can quickly consume half your budget before you even pick out a tile.
How to Fix It: Before committing to a total layout overhaul, explore how much you can achieve by keeping your utilities in their current locations. Often, high-quality custom kitchen cabinets Orlando and a clever new island configuration can provide the "modern" feel you crave without the massive expense of moving the "guts" of the house. 7. Chasing the "Now" Over the "Forever"
Trends move fast. What is "vibrant" and "chic" today might feel dated and tired in five years. While it’s fun to incorporate the latest colors and textures, a kitchen that is built entirely on fleeting trends can hurt your home’s resale value and leave you feeling the itch to remodel all over again much sooner than you expected.

How to Fix It: Aim for a timeless foundation. Choose neutral, high-quality finishes for your custom kitchen cabinets Orlando and countertops. These elements serve as a sophisticated backdrop. Then, inject personality and "modern" flair through hardware, lighting, and decor: items that are easy and inexpensive to update as your tastes evolve. This approach creates a "sanctuary" that remains stylish for decades.
